One way to get people to create content for you is through contests. A common form of contest among companies is the “create a commercial&# contest. Among organizations, contests may seem like a short-cut to get compelling content, and cheaply. The current Heinz contest is a great example.

Explore this definitive guide to learn more about Giving Tuesday, get great campaign ideas, and soak up some best practices. Build your campaign contact lists. Make sure you’re tailoring your messages to different groups of people by creating multiple contact lists, like a segment of new supporters and a segment of longtime supporters.
